B.B. King, blues musician
Riley B. King was born on September 16, 1925, on a cotton plantation in Itta Bena, Mississippi, just outside the Mississippi delta town of Indianola. Playing on street corners for dimes, B.B. (Blues Boy) King would often play in as many as four towns on a Saturday night. At age 22, armed with his guitar and $2.50, B.B. hitchhiked to Memphis to pursue his musical career. Along that path, with the help of legendary blues musicians and the talent to make a guitar sing, B.B. King became and remains the King of the Blues. Indianola will soon celebrate the opening of the B. B. King Museum and Delta Interpretive Center dedicated to the establishment of a museum honoring B. B. King, which tells his life's story of hardship, perseverance, talent and humility as a way to further the arts, youth development, and racial reconciliation in the Mississippi Delta and beyond.
